Development of Virtual Simulation System for Subsea Hardware Installation Procedure

摘要

Subsea production system is widely used in the development of offshore oil fields owe to its unique advantages.The South China Sea is rich in oil and gas reservoir where the water depth ranges from 500m to 2000m, but the installation capacity in China is up to 300m water depth.Based on the analysis of the installation procedures for deep water facilities, this paper focuses on the development of virtual simulation system for the installation procedure of subsea production facilities by using commercial softwares such as MultiGen Creator and Vega Prime.This system is developed to realize the designing,previewing and training for deepwater installation, meanwhile, it will provide a virtual offshore platform for the development of oil fields located in deepwater.
